The Dallas Mavericks were established in 1980 by entrepreneur Don Carter. The team quickly made a name for itself, reaching the playoffs for the first time in 1984. This section will explore the team's evolution, major milestones, and key events that shaped its history.

1.1 Early Years and Establishment

In the inaugural season, the Mavericks struggled but showed promise. The team's first-ever victory came against the San Antonio Spurs, setting the stage for future success. Throughout the 1980s, the Mavericks began to build a competitive roster, highlighted by the acquisition of players like Mark Aguirre and Derek Harper.

1.2 Rise to Prominence

The 1990s marked a turning point for the Mavericks. With the addition of players such as Jamal Mashburn and Steve Nash, the team became a playoff contender. However, it wasn’t until the early 2000s that the Mavericks truly emerged as a powerhouse in the league.

3.1 The 2011 Championship Run

Led by Dirk Nowitzki, the Mavericks faced off against the Miami Heat in the NBA Finals. The series was a rollercoaster, with the Mavericks overcoming a 2-1 deficit to claim the championship in six games. This victory was not only significant for the team but also for the city of Dallas, solidifying the Mavericks as a key player in NBA history.

4.1 Don Nelson and the Mavericks' Early Success

Don Nelson, one of the most successful coaches in NBA history, played a crucial role in the Mavericks' development during the 1980s and 1990s. His innovative approach to the game laid the foundation for the team's future successes.

4.2 Rick Carlisle and the Championship Era

Rick Carlisle took over as head coach in 2008 and led the Mavericks to their first championship in 2011. His emphasis on teamwork, defense, and strategic play was pivotal in the Mavericks' success during that period.
